Pakistani Players will receive their visas today, and they will depart for India on September 27 for ICC Cricket World Cup 2023.

The issuance of Indian visas to Pakistani players took longer than expected. According to recent rumors, Pakistani athletes will receive their visas on September 25.

The Pakistani team will play New Zealand in a pre-ICC World Cup 2023 warm-up game. On Friday, October 29, the game is held at Hyderabad’s Rajiv Gandhi Stadium.

Babar Azam and co. will receive their Indian visas today, claims Cricket Pakistan. The procedure entails the Indian Interior Ministry issuing No Objection Certificates (NOCs) to the Indian Embassy in Pakistan. The procedure was, however, delayed.

Notably, the International Cricket Council (ICC) had been contacted by the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) over the issue of visa delays. The Pakistani team will depart for Hyderabad on Wednesday morning via Dubai after receiving their visas.

The Pakistani squad had to shorten their travel to Dubai as a result of the vias delay. Prior to traveling to India, the team had intended to spend two days in Dubai. They will no longer stop in Dubai for two days as they go on to India.

On September 29, Pakistan will meet New Zealand in a pregame match. They will face the Netherlands on October 6 to begin their ICC World Cup 2023 campaign. Pakistan recently revealed their team for the ICC World Cup in 2023.

In the competition, Babar Azam will serve as the team’s captain. The Pakistani World Cup team is listed below.

Babar Azam (C), Shadab Khan (VC), Abdullah Shafique, Fakhar Zaman, Haris Rauf, Hasan Ali, Iftikhar Ahmed, Imam-ul-Haq, Mohammad Nawaz, Mohammad Rizwan, Mohammad Wasim Jr., Salman Agha, Saud Shakeel, Shaheen Shah Afridi, and Usama Mir are the members of Pakistan’s squad for the ICC World Cup 2023. Mohammad Harris, Ibrar Ahmed, and Zaman Khan are the reserves.
